Unhappy Conehead Syndrome

After Frankie removed his sutures post-surgery, he has been relegated to being a conehead. His displeasure is quite obvious.

Frankie was doing great Wednesday after the surgery to remove a mass on his back leg, so Hu-Dad  didn’t take any extra precautions. Since Frankie is the only dog who sleeps all night in the human bed (Typhoon starts there, but then leaves as soon as humans take over), Hu-Dad figured he would notice if Frankie became uncomfortable or picked at his surgery site. Well, guess what? Frankie quietly removed every single suture while Hu-Dad slept.

The result of Frankie’s medical efforts was a return to the vet on Thursday, the replacement of the sutures, and the introduction of the cone. This is the very first time ever that Frankie has had to wear a cone and he is not exactly happy about it. He only is allowed out of the cone when Hu-Dad can watch him every single second, so that will mean lots of cone time for the next several days,.
